Operations Manual for a Compact Electromechanical Fatigue Testing Machine,

Abstract

This document gives details of the design and operation of two recently developed load controlled electromechanical shaker systems. These systems have been designed to test materials including composites, alloys and pure metals with either three or four point bending loads. One system (Mk I) is designed for room temperature testing only and the other (Mk II) can also be used at elevated temperatures. The electronic control and drive circuits include new designs by the author, published designs modified by the author and circuits developed earlier at AMRL. The loading frame and ancillary hardware were designed and built at AMRL.
